London - Four people were taken to hospital last night when the nose wheel of a passenger aircraft collapsed as it landed at Bournemouth International Airport.

A spokeswoman for the airport said two children and two adults were taken to Poole General Hospital as a precaution.

In a separate incident, flights in and out of Gatwick Airport were diverted last night after a Boeing 767 carrying 146 people slid off the runway and into mud. None of the passengers or crew on board the Britannia flight from Manchester to Gatwick were injured.
